Hello,

I have a marriage in 1767 at Dudley St Thomas, by licence, between Benjamin Lakin of Tamworth and Mary Green of Dudley.

Where can I find records of the diocese for marriage licences of this period? I am hoping to gain more information about the wife in this instance, as she is so far untraceable.

I was thinking that Bonds and Allegations would be at Stafford Record Office (Diocese of Lichfield) - assuming they have survived.  However, just looked at my guide book and Dudley comes under the diocese of Worcester, so you may need to contact Worcester Records Office.

Not sure that they would help with Mary, but "if you don't ask the question, you won't get an answer".  ;D

ADDED:  Sorry, just looked at the Diocese of Lichfield records on FindMyPast, and there is nothing there.

Bonds and Allegations....just looked at my guide book and Dudley comes under the diocese of Worcester, so you may need to contact Worcester Records Office.

It is indexed on FamilySearch (as is the marriage on 25 Aug 1767)
Benjamin Lakin + Mary Green
Event Type: Marriage
Event Date: 24 Aug 1767
Event Place: Worcestershire, England
https://www.familysearch.org/ark:/61903/1:1:QGTN-HK9C

Digital Folder Number 007760132
which is Calendar of allegations of marriages, 1720-1786, Diocese of Worcester

So that tells us when. There seem to be three films of Worcester diocese marriage bonds and allegations, 1766-1767, but not viewiable at home
